About Checkmarx MCP Server

Connect your Checkmarx One enterprise environment to any AI agent and take programmatic control over your Application Security posture. Analyze deep code flaws through natural chat instead of navigating complex cyber dashboards.

Claude Code registers Checkmarx as an MCP server in a single terminal command. Once connected, Claude Code discovers all 10 tools at runtime and can call them headlessly — ideal for CI/CD pipelines, cron jobs, and automated workflows where Checkmarx data drives decisions without human intervention.

What you can do

  • Projects & Applications — Inventory your codebase containers, inspect active project linkages, and prepare specific branches for security scanning
  • Scans Lifecycle — Trigger dynamic SAST/SCA security scans on repos, cancel redundant queues, and poll engines for precise execution timing
  • Vulnerability Triage — Extract core datasets of severe vulnerabilities, mapping exact lines of code where the flawed logic resides
  • Best Fix Location (BFL) — Ask the agent to calculate the exact optimal spot in your execution path to apply a patch that resolves the flaw entirely
  • KICS (IaC) — Read specialized Infrastructure as Code metrics isolating misconfigurations exclusively in Terraform, Dockerfiles, or Kubernetes YAML

Checkmarx MCP Tools for Claude Code (10)

These 10 tools become available when you connect Checkmarx to Claude Code via MCP:

01

cancel_scan

Prevents unnecessary engine resource consumption and drops the scanning context if the developer pushed a new commit overlapping the running job. Cancel an actively running Checkmarx scan

02

get_kics_results

Focuses solely on Terraform, CloudFormation, Kubernetes YAML, and Dockerfile misconfigurations rather than typical application source code flaws. Get specialized Infrastructure as Code (KICS) findings

03

get_project

Essential for ensuring the correct branch and source control context is selected before triggering new scans. Get details for a specific Checkmarx project

04

get_scan_details

It returns granular execution details including which scan engines (SAST, SCA, KICS) were fired, their individual execution timings, and any engine-specific failure reasons. Check the precise status and configuration of a Checkmarx scan

05

get_scan_results

Each result includes the vulnerability severity, state (To Verify, Confirmed, Urgent), description, and the exact lines of code where the flaw was detected. Requires a completed scan ID. Download SAST and security vulnerability findings for a scan

06

list_applications

An Application acts as an overarching container for multiple individual microservices or projects, providing aggregated risk reporting and security metric visibility across a logical product. List Checkmarx One Applications

07

list_bfl

Provide the scan ID and the specific query (rule) ID string. Get Best Fix Location (BFL) for a specific vulnerability node

08

list_projects

A Project represents a specific codebase. Includes project metadata, IDs, and assigned application linkages. List all Checkmarx One Projects

09

list_scans

Includes the scan ID, current status (Completed, Running, Failed, Canceled), branch targeted, and timestamps. Use the scan ID to fetch the actual vulnerability results. List all historical and active scans for a Checkmarx project

10

run_scan

Extensively used in CI/CD integrations to assert security quality on PRs. Returns the ID of the newly queued scan. Trigger a new Checkmarx One code scan

Checkmarx + Claude Code FAQ

Common questions about integrating Checkmarx MCP Server with Claude Code.

01

How do I add an MCP server to Claude Code?

Run claude mcp add --transport http "" in your terminal. Claude Code registers the server and discovers all tools immediately.
02

Can Claude Code run MCP tools in headless mode?

Yes. Claude Code supports non-interactive execution, making it ideal for scripts, cron jobs, and CI/CD pipelines that need MCP tool access.
03

How do I list all connected MCP servers?

Run claude mcp in your terminal to see all registered servers and their status, or type /mcp inside an active Claude Code session.
